>> >> >> >> Ok heres my new results:
>>
>> >> >> >> Windows 7 MD v1.1
>> >> >> >> Celeron M 420 @ 1.6Ghz (original clock)
>> >> >> >> 2GB 222Mhz DDR2
>>
>> >> >> >> Processor: 3.1
>> >> >> >> Memory (RAM): 4.5
>> >> >> >> Graphics: 2.0
>> >> >> >> Gaming Graphics: 3.0
>> >> >> >> Primary Hard Disk: 4.3
>>
>> >> >> >> Same machine only with PCI/PCI-E/DDR frequency jacked up to max, and
>> >> >> >> CPU clock at 1.9Ghz (via SetFSB)
>> >> >> >> Processor: 3.6 (slightly boosted)
>> >> >> >> Memory (RAM): 4.7 (slightly boosted)
>> >> >> >> Graphics: 2.9 (significiant boost)
>> >> >> >> Gaming Graphics: 3.1 (slightly boosted)
>> >> >> >> Primary Hard Disk: 4.4 (slightly boosted)
>>
>> >> >> >> So maybe the CPU does make the difference. Idk if I'm that convinced
>> >> >> >> though since gaming graphics barely moved....
